Joseph A. “Joe” Kring, of Dowagiac, formerly of Niles, 52, passed away on Sunday, July 13, 2014 at The Timbers of Cass County, following a brief illness.

He was born on Aug. 14, 1961, in South Bend to Roland E. and Mary A. (Martin) Kring.

Joe was a 1981 graduate of Brandywine High School. While Joe was gifted in many different areas, he mostly enjoyed his transportation business where he was able to drive people anywhere they needed.

Joe will be remembered for having a heart of gold and always wanting to make others happy. He was a member of the Niles Boy Scout Troop #550, a member of the Knights of Columbus 708, a longtime participant in the Special Olympics and had been a longtime member of St. Mark Catholic Church.

In his spare-time Joe enjoyed NASCAR, the Cubs, Notre Dame sports and bowling. Joe was gifted at playing the organ and loved to cook.

He was preceded in death by his father Roland E. Kring and two brothers Thomas and Robert Kring.

Joe is survived by his mother Mary A. Kring of Niles, three brothers; Roland “Ronnie” Kring of Hanahan, South Carolina, Bill (Susan) Kring of Niles, John (Sheryl) Kring of Niles, three sisters; Susan (Mike) Marshall of Mishawaka, Sandy (Garry) Asmus of Dowagiac, and Therese (Bill) Besemann of Minot, North Dakota as well as many nieces, nephews and friends.

The family will receive relatives and friends from 5.to 8 p.m. on Tuesday, July 15, 2014, at Brown Funeral Home, Niles with recitation of The Rosary at 7:30 p.m.

The Mass of Christian Burial for Joseph A. Kring will be celebrated at 9:30 a.m. Wednesday, July 16, 2014 at Saint Mark Catholic Church, Niles, by The Rev. Thomas King, C.S.C. of the church. Committal Rites will follow at Chapel Hill Cemetery, Osceola, Indiana.

Memorial contributions may be made in Joe’s memory to the Special Olympics or the Niles Knights of Columbus.
